In contrast, when you're boring for shelf pins, it's 37mm in from the cabinet front, 37mm in from the inside of the back panel, and a line centered between the front and rear holes. You'll note, too, that the fixed part of the glides set back roughly 2mm from the front of the cabinet when you have the first line of holes at 37mm from the front edge of the cabinet. You'll note that most gaps between hole lines are 128mm EXCEPT between the second and third hole lines where it drops to 96mm. One example would be the Accuride glides that I use. Quote from: Sparktrician on March 03, 2020, 08:21 AM Remember to set the holes closest to the front at 37mm from the front edge of the cabinet sides, then space the second, third, etc., holes at predetermined gaps from the first hole as you progress toward the back of the cabinet, and all reference on the first hole at 37mm from the front. The rear row of holes is not as critical, but should be bored so that one of the rear holes in your slides will line up. Other manufacturer's hardware works with the same setback (Grass, Salice, etc.) Once you've chosen a base plate position, you simply drill the hinge cup in the door to match. The hinge base plates fit exactly into a pair of holes spaced 32mm and require the same 37mm set back. With holes bored at a 37mm set back, these slides can be placed at exactly the 3mm set back per the installation specs. The holes in the Tandem slides are machined to accept 5mm euro screws. I normally use Blum Tandem undermount drawer slides. This is a standard setback for euro hardware. I bore my front holes with a "set back" of 37 mm from the front edge of the carcass.
